Summer Camp Week 3 (June 17-21) There will be no camp on Wednesday, June 19, 2024.The Atlanta Historical Society was founded in 1926 to preserve and study Atlanta history. In 1990, after decades of collecting, researching, and publishing information about Atlanta and the surrounding area, the organization officially became Atlanta History Center. What began as a small, archival-focused historical society grew over the ... Over 20 years after the 1996 Olympic and Paralympic Games, the exhibition considers the impact of the Games on the city and our lives.A 30-minute documentary film produced by Atlanta History Center that explores the history of the monument from all angles, including the origin of the carving, the complicated relationships between the carving and …The enormous painting, 49 feet tall and 371 feet in circumference, debuted in Minneapolis in June 1886. It then travelled to, Indianapolis, Chattanooga, Nashville, and finally to Atlanta where it has been exhibited —with few interruptions— since 1892. At four feet in diameter, Backstreet nightclub proudly held the largest disco ball in the Southeast. Located at 845 Peachtree Street in Midtown, Backstreet was a 24-hour dance club, bar, cabaret, and entertainment center composed of three levels and 10,000 square feet. This unique experience was created in 2003 by the Atlanta Preservation Center as a way to celebrate the anniversary of the powerful rescue of the Fox Theatre, an event that …Importantly, the Atlanta Campaign of 1864 was the turning point in the Civil War. Atlanta was a critical city in the South – transportation hub, industrial center, and warehouse for food, ammunition, supplies, uniforms, and other military material crucial to Confederate Armies. We believe that by increasing access to stories about our shared history, …Depicting the 1864 Battle of Atlanta—a Civil War turning point—the fully restored The Battle of Atlanta painting is at the heart of the Atlanta History Center’s Cyclorama: The Big Picture experience. The painting rises 49 feet, stretches 371 feet (longer than a football field) and weighs 10,000 pounds. Atlanta’s Fire Station No. 7. The beginning of fire protection in Atlanta can be marked with the 1848 bucket brigade ordinance, which was implemented as the population surged to nearly 2,000. Volunteer fire companies served the city up until 1882 when professionals began …Album is a database of over 25,000 digital assets from 119 archival collections and publications available at the Kenan Research Center at the Atlanta History Center. …Atlanta History Center’s collection features 55,000 museum artifacts, over 17,000 linear feet of archival and library collections, and 33 acres of living collections (150 families; 493 genera; 1,129 species; 1,706 taxa; 5,206 accessions). On February 22, 2019, Atlanta History Center opened Cyclorama: The Big Picture, featuring the fully restored cyclorama painting, The Battle of Atlanta. In the 1880s, The Battle of Atlanta cyclorama painting was an immersive experience — the equivalent of virtual reality today.
